GBP/JPY Daily Chart: Reverse or Extent?

I drew trendlines on GBP/JPY Daily chart just now and got this as a result. I also tried to count the movement from the bottom and added 30 and 50 EMA to visualize the trend. 30 EMA has been above 50 EMA since March and I count 5 significant waves. For now, the pair formed double top with support at current low and 'wave 4' low. The selling point should be below the first support with target at the next support (wave 4 low). Or, buy the pair now with risk below the first support and target the upper channel or even the 161.8 extension of wave 3 and 4 Which one? Buy? Sell?? GBPJPY Weekly Chart: Bounced & Close Below 30 EMA

Since my last post, the pair has reached as high as 162.58 before going down again to 154.05, which gave support for the pair. However, after sideways for the last 3 weeks, it went down for 1,000 pips this week. The pair also closed below 30 EMA, meaning that more down should be anticipated for the following week. The pair almost touch 38.2% retracement of 118.80 (low) to 162.58 (high) at 145.86. The target remains the same which is the 50% retracement at 140.69 area. That's all, have nice weekend. GBPJPY Weekly Chart: Bounce Off 50 EMA Resistance

The retracement from 118.80 may come to an end as the pair has touch 50 EMA on weekly chart, or 38.2% retracement of 215.85 to 118.80 with 'high' at 160.45. Potential target for short is the 50% retracement of the retracement at 139.63 and may extend to test the 118.80 'low'.
